在Flutter中,可以使用RichText
和TextSpan
来为文本列表中的中间文本设置更大的字体。下面是一个示例代码:
import 'package:flutter/material.dart';
void main() {
runApp(MyApp());
}
class MyApp extends StatelessWidget {
@override
Widget build(BuildContext context) {
return MaterialApp(
home: Scaffold(
appBar: AppBar(
title: Text('Text List'),
),
body: Center(
child: Column(
mainAxisAlignment: MainAxisAlignment.center,
children: [
Text('这是一段文本列表:'),
SizedBox(height: 10),
RichText(
text: TextSpan(
children: [
TextSpan(
text: '第一行文本\n',
style: TextStyle(fontSize: 16),
),
TextSpan(
text: '第二行文本\n',
style: TextStyle(fontSize: 24),
),
TextSpan(
text: '第三行文本\n',
style: TextStyle(fontSize: 16),
),
],
),
),
],
),
),
),
);
}
}
在上面的示例中,我们使用RichText
和TextSpan
来创建一个文本列表。通过设置不同的fontSize
属性,可以为中间的文本设置更大的字体。在这个例子中,第二行文本的字体大小为24,其他文本的字体大小为16。
这是一个简单的示例,你可以根据自己的需求进行更复杂的文本样式设置。关于Flutter的更多信息和相关产品,你可以访问腾讯云的Flutter开发者中心了解更多。
领取专属 10元无门槛券
手把手带您无忧上云